An eight-year-old girl needed hospital treatment, after being hit by a car in Shropshire.

She was struck by a blue Citroën Picasso on Mount Pleasant Road in Shrewsbury at about 17:20 BST on Thursday.

The pedestrian suffered injuries to her arm in the collision near to the junction with Whitemere Road and attended hospital.

West Mercia Police said officers would like to see any dashcam footage of the incident or speak to any witnesses.
